sub gen_monthly_calendar {
    my %args = @_;
    my $m = $args{month};
    my $y = $args{year};

    my @lines;
    my $tz = $args{time_zone} // $ENV{TZ} // "UTC";
    my $dt  = DateTime->new(year=>$y, month=>$m, day=>1, time_zone=>$tz);
    my $dtl = DateTime->last_day_of_month(year=>$y, month=>$m, time_zone=>$tz);
    my $dt_today = DateTime->today(time_zone=>$tz);

    my $hol = [];
    if ($args{dates} && @{ $args{dates} }) {
        $hol = $args{dates};
    } else {
        for my $mod0 (@{ $args{caldates_modules} // [] }) {
            my $mod = $mod0; $mod =~ s!/!::!g;
            $mod = "Calendar::Dates::$mod" unless $mod =~ /\ACalendar::Dates::/;
            (my $mod_pm = "$mod.pm") =~ s!::!/!g;
            require $mod_pm;
            my $res; eval { $res = $mod->get_entries($y, $m) }; next if $@;
            for (@$res) { $_->{module} = $mod0 }
            push @$hol, @$res;
        }
    }
    $hol = [sort {$a->{date} cmp $b->{date}} @$hol];

    # XXX use locale
    if ($args{show_year_in_title} // 1) {
        push @lines, _center(21, sprintf("%s %d", $month_names->[$m-1], $y));
    } else {
        push @lines, _center(21, sprintf("%s", $month_names->[$m-1]));
    }

    push @lines, "Mo Tu We Th Fr Sa Su"; # XXX use locale, option to start on Sunday

    my $dow = $dt->day_of_week;
    $dt->subtract(days => $dow-1);
    for my $i (1..$dow-1) {
        push @lines, "" if $i == 1;
        if ($args{show_prev_month_days} // 1) {
            $lines[-1] .= sprintf("%s%2d \e[0m", ansifg("404040"), $dt->day);
        } else {
            $lines[-1] .= "   ";
        }
        $dt->add(days => 1);
    }
    for (1..$dtl->day) {
        if ($dt->day_of_week == 1) {
            push @lines, "";
        }
        my $col = "808080";
        my $reverse;
        if (($args{highlight_today}//1) && DateTime->compare($dt, $dt_today) == 0) {
            $reverse++;
        } else {
            for (@$hol) {
                if ($dt->day == $_->{day}) {
                    #my $is_holiday = $_->{is_holiday} ||
                    #    (grep {$_ eq 'holiday'} @{ $_->{tags} // [] });
                    $col = assign_rgb_light_color($_->{module} // "dates");
                    $reverse++ if $args{dates};
                }
            }
        }
        $lines[-1] .= sprintf("%s%s%2d \e[0m", $reverse ? "\e[7m" : "", ansifg($col), $dt->day);
        $dt->add(days => 1);
    }
    if ($args{show_next_month_days} // 1) {
        $dow = $dt->day_of_week - 1; $dow = 7 if $dow == 0;
        for my $i ($dow+1..7) {
            $lines[-1] .= sprintf("%s%2d \e[0m", ansifg("404040"), $dt->day);
            $dt->add(days => 1);
        }
    }

    return [\@lines, $hol];
}
